#8ad97d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8ad97d is composed of 54.1% red, 85.1%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 111.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 67.1%. #8ad97d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ffa with #15b300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#8ad97d color description : Very soft lime green.

#8ad97d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8ad97d has RGB values of R:138, G:217,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 9099645.

Shades and Tints of #8ad97d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030702 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8ad97d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aacaa is the less saturated color, while #73f95d is the most saturated one.
